Got a minute? Could you explain your research in just sixty seconds in an innovative and creative way?

Developing skills that engage non-technical, non-specialist public audiences with our research are a vital requirement for today’s scientists.

That’s the challenge in the MVLS Impact in 60 Seconds Competition 2018, which offers postgraduate researchers a chance to develop these skills by creating an original one minute film highlighting their research to a public audience.
